The Big Apple Film Festival (BAFF) is a New York City-based event dedicated to showcasing and promoting high-quality independent films from the local community and around the world. Established over two decades ago, it has been recognized by MovieMaker Magazine as one of the "Top 25 Coolest Film Festivals" and "Top 25 Festivals Worth the Entry Fee." BAFF features film screenings, a screenplay competition, and provides networking and pitch opportunities with industry professionals, honoring filmmakers and writers who have influenced independent cinema. The festival has showcased projects that have gone on to receive Academy Awards and nominations.
